The video tutorial explains the concept of a federal government, where power is shared between a strong central government and state or local governments. It highlights countries like Germany, Russia, Australia, and the United States that have federal systems. The US federal government is structured into three branches: Executive, Legislative, and Judiciary. The video discusses the unique powers of the federal government, such as foreign relations and currency minting, and contrasts them with state powers. It also covers the system of checks and balances that ensures power is balanced between federal and state governments, and concludes with a discussion on the benefits of a federal system.
